MLS Matchday 15 Preview: California Clash, Messi's Test in Philly, Atlanta Under Pressure


Matchday 15 of the MLS season promises high drama and shifting narratives across the league. As reported by MLSsoccer.com, three matchups stand out: San Diego FC host LA Galaxy in a budding California derby, Inter Miami look to regroup in Philadelphia, and Atlanta United face a critical test at home against FC Cincinnati.
Saturday's early spotlight falls on Snapdragon Stadium, where San Diego FC welcome the winless LA Galaxy. The expansion club shocked the league on opening day with a 2-0 win over their SoCal rivals and have since climbed to third in the West. Key to their success are DP stars Anders Dreyer and Chucky Lozano, who have combined for 10 goals and 12 assists. LA, meanwhile, showed signs of life in a 2-2 El Tráfico draw, sparked by a Marco Reus brace.
Later that evening, the Philadelphia Union host a struggling Inter Miami. Lionel Messi and Luis Suárez were powerless in their recent 3-0 loss to Orlando, extending a poor run of just one win in seven. "Now we’ll see if we’re really a team," Messi stated postmatch. Philadelphia, under Bradley Carnell, lead both the East and the Supporters' Shield race, with Golden Boot leader Tai Baribo (11 goals) leading the charge.
Sunday night sees Atlanta United seeking to reverse a dismal run against high-flying FC Cincinnati. The Five Stripes haven’t won in eight and recently fell at home to Philly. Cincinnati, on the other hand, are surging thanks to club-record scorer Kévin Denkey and MVP hopeful Evander, and currently sit second in the league by points per game.
